Master of Science in Strategic Marketing

The Master’s in Strategic Marketing online program is a thirty-one (31) credit hour degree program is designed to develop high-level analytical and strategic approaches within marketing. With a focus on data-driven strategy in business development and performance growth, this master’s in strategic marketing equips marketing professionals to tap into data analytics and innovative digital marketing techniques to stay competitive at global scale.

Mission & Goals

This strategic marketing master’s degree program builds out the relevant skills and insights in analytics, digital marketing, and emergent technologies such as AI to position students to:

Leverage advanced digital marketing tools and techniques to create comprehensive strategies that effectively engage digital-first audiences and optimize online presence.
Demonstrate proficiency in integrating sales management and customer relationship strategies with traditional and digital marketing plans to enhance customer loyalty, drive sales growth, and improve business outcomes.
Master the ability to develop and manage powerful brand strategies in both consumer and business markets, understanding the unique challenges and opportunities in each sector.
Interpret complex data sets to make evidence-based marketing decisions, enabling them to address and adapt to dynamic market conditions effectively.
